Pasadena Memorial came into Tuesday's contest looking for another win against MacArthur, but Andrew Victrum wouldn't allow it. The Generals secured a 57-52 W over the Mavericks on Tuesday with plenty of help from Victrum, who posted 20 points and seven steals. He is becoming a predictor of MacArthur's success: when he posts at least five steals the team is 2-1 (and 6-9 when he doesn't).
Joshua Morales was another key player, putting up six points and five rebounds. He is also on a roll when it comes to field goal percentage, as he's posted one of at least 50% in the last five games he's played.
MacArthur has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won seven of their last eight matchups. That's provided a massive bump to their 8-10 record this season. Those wins came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 56.6 points over those games. As for Pasadena Memorial,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 7-11.
MacArthur did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next game, a 91-65 loss against La Porte on the 30th. As for Pasadena Memorial, they have also already played their next contest, a 67-52 victory against Dekaney on the 30th.
